OTL Carranza was able to get diplomatic recognition of his government from the US in exchange for guaranteed neutrality so the US wouldn't have to worry about losing Mexican oil.

So having accomplished this I'm not sure what more the Carranza government would expect to get out of formally entering the war on the other side.
